SNAP Payments Delayed. Millions Will Not Receive Benefits.
Let’s Step Up Together.
- The federal shutdown has paused or delayed SNAP (food assistance) payments for millions of residents of NJ and PA.
- Seniors, families, and people on fixed incomes are among the hardest hit.
- Local food banks are stepping in to fill the gap, and your help is urgently needed.
